Business and Environment
The Supply Chain Partnerships for Environmental Management and Pollution Prevention Program aims to set high environmental standards on the efficient use of water, energy and raw materials as well as proper waste management. The program also supports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) in implementing good environmental practices.

The Water for Life for Metro Manila and Southern Luzon provinces Program aims to ensure supply and access to clean water for Metro Manila and nearby provinces; restore biodiversity and maintain ecological balance in the 5 watershed areas; and provide livelihood and income opportunities for the communities in a manner that is culturally acceptable, appropriate, environment-friendly and economically sustainable. Aside from reforestation and livelihood, there is also a training component, which focuses on values formation to enhancement of technical skills such as forest management.
